Are estate agents still showing properties?

We are due to put the house on the market this week. However, with the latest news coming from the PM, should we go ahead and will estate agents even be working?
I guess it will be a supply and demand thing but we are so unsure like many what we should do, we are end of chain. On the one had we want to get on with it and on the other there are strict rules about socialising.
What are your thoughts?

    Last night's Government guidance (below) does not specifically mention geezers with liveried minis, shiny suits and gelled hair, but simply says

    "All retail with notable exceptions" must close. Exceptions are listed as; "Supermarkets and other food shops, health shops, pharmacies including nondispensing pharmacies, petrol stations, bicycle shops, home and hardware shops, laundrettes and dry cleaners, bicycle shops, garages, car rentals, pet shops, corner shops, newsagents, post offices, and banks".

    So while online sale sites will, presumably display properties, I wouldn't let strangers wander round my house at the mo...
